Staging and production use identical compression codecs so that security review findings transfer cleanly between environments; only buffer sizes and key-rotation windows differ. Payloads are compressed after field-level redaction, never before, which keeps sensitive attributes out of dictionary state. Reviewers should confirm that the dictionary reset interval matches the documented retention policy in each tier. The production environment currently runs with the settings below.

deployment values, kajep-kageg:
[praix]
host = praix.paliqcorp.corp
user = praix_svc
database = praix_prod

Memo — Sales Leads

Effective next quarter, Quillbase moves all new contracts to annual billing only. Monthly plans close to new sales immediately; existing accounts grandfather for one renewal cycle. Updated pricing sheets ship Friday. Hold all exceptions for VP approval. The reasoning behind the shift is in the confidential note below.

board note of bawep-tajef: Queniusek Systems plans to raise the Quenvan list price by 53.1 percent in March. The pricing group signed off on a budget of $176.4 million for Project Drueth. The renewal with Casionix Partners closes at $142.5 million a year, 8.3 percent below the last contract. Project Fraax slips by six weeks because of the tooling delay.

**FAQ: Where is reception now?**

As of this month, the Kestrelworth reception desk has moved from the second floor to the ground floor, just inside the main entrance on the atrium side. All visitors should now be directed there for sign-in, and couriers will drop parcels at the new desk rather than the loading bay. The old second-floor desk is decommissioned and will become a quiet working area. If the ground-floor side door is locked before 08:00, use your pass code.

turnstile pass: bdg-NG-3

Subject: Key rotation — Taxgrove lookup cache

Team,

We rotated the service key for the Taxgrove tax-rate lookup cache this morning as part of the quarterly schedule. The old key stops working at 18:00 UTC today. If you're on call, update the cache-warmer config on both Fenwick nodes before then; nothing else consumes this credential. The new key is:

service key, kaduf-bawig: kto15_Ze79S0dligTw0yO